Danielle DeRosa, P.Eng. has a diverse work experience in the field of structural engineering. Danielle started their career as a Structural Engineering Intern at Sobotec Ltd., where they prepared engineering calculations and developed design solutions for exterior wall cladding systems. Danielle also worked as a Teaching Assistant at McMaster University and Queen's University, where they assisted in teaching and conducting research on reinforced concrete structures and low-temperature effects. Danielle then joined RWDI as a Technical Coordinator, analyzing wind tunnel data and calculating wind loads for structural and cladding design. Danielle later worked at Sobotec Ltd. as a Design Engineer, designing custom aluminum architectural cladding elements and their anchorage systems. Currently, Danielle is working at StressCrete Group as a Structural Engineer and Director of Engineering - Structural, overseeing the engineering department and contributing to structural design projects.

Danielle DeRosa, P.Eng. completed their Bachelor of Engineering (B.Eng.) in Civil Engineering from McMaster University from 2005 to 2010. Danielle then pursued their Master of Applied Science (M.A.Sc.) in Structural Engineering at Queen's University from 2010 to 2012.
